If there is one artist who has managed to preserve that sense of wonder from childhood, it’s Jacob Collier. Here he is on a sunny day in Paris performing his delicate ballad ‘Thom Thumb’, inspired by the English folk tale character.
‘Thom Thumb, thought you were gone / And I found you inside of everything’. Another song that goes straight to the heart, thanks Jacob.
